About CritiCare Home Health & Nursing Services

CritiCare is a family owned, Commonwealth of Pennsylvania licensed and Medicare certified skilled Home Health agency. The skilled license means that CritiCare can provide a full range of services from companion care to hi-tech registered nursing to you or your loved ones, adult or child, at home or at school or wherever the client may be. Serving Chester and Delaware counties.
